Job Summary: Field Service Operator responsible for meter reading, debt management, customer service, and incident resolution. Key Highlights: 1. Dynamic role involving fieldwork and customer service 2. End-to-end service management, from meter reading to incident resolution 3. Verification of infrastructure and commercial data **Position Title:** Field Service Operator – Taltal **Work Schedule:** Rotating shifts: Monday to Friday, 08:00 (AM) to 16:54 (PM)\-Monday to Friday, 16:30 (PM) to 01:24 (AM) **Contract Type:** Project-based **Location:** Tocopilla **Responsibilities:** Collect meter readings in the field while ensuring compliance with health, environmental, and safety standards and regulations. Manage debt-related visits to recover payments, execute service disconnections, and perform reconnections once the situation is resolved. Verify both infrastructure and commercial data of the visited property. Deliver documents sent to customers (e.g., invoices, central billing slips, notifications, others). **Perform administrative tasks such as:** reporting, statistics, and reports; respond to mailboxes and emails. Provide customer service in person, by phone, or remotely, according to company needs. Visit and manage meters experiencing communication failures with antennas, per ADASA instructions, restarting them via application to restore connectivity. Respond to leak alarms by visiting customers to inform them about internal leaks, guide repairs, and prevent excessive water consumption that may lead to high water bills. Inspect potential violations by verifying on-site the condition of meters upon receiving alarms triggered by unauthorized tampering. Inspect possible leaks by conducting on-site verification using leak detection instruments and reporting findings through designated channels and procedures. **Requirements:** Completed secondary education. Technical studies preferred. Possession of Class B driver’s license.
